For the 1999 model year, the Kawasaki VN 1500 Classic Tourer motorcycle has a listed dry weight of 729.7 lb (331 kg).
Kawasaki VN 1500 Classic Tourer weight overview
This is a very heavy motorcycle. Good footing, sensible parking direction and avoiding awkward slopes make a real difference when handling it at walking speed. The comparison uses dry weight because a usable wet/running figure was not supplied, so the actual ready-to-ride motorcycle will be heavier.

How much does the Kawasaki VN 1500 Classic Tourer weigh?
The source data gives 729.7 lb (331 kg) as dry weight. A fueled, road-ready bike will weigh more than this figure.
How does the Kawasaki VN 1500 Classic Tourer weight compare with similar Kawasakis?
It is on the heavier side. Its representative dry weight is around the 96th percentile among 81 compatible Kawasaki motorcycles.
What does a full tank of gas weigh on the Kawasaki VN 1500 Classic Tourer?
A full tank works out to about 26.3 lb (11.9 kg) from the listed 4.23 US gal (16 L) capacity. Actual fuel density varies slightly, so treat it as a practical estimate.
What does the Kawasaki VN 1500 Classic Tourer weigh with a 180 lb rider?
The approximate combined total is 909.7 lb (412.6 kg) with a 180 lb rider, based on the representative dry weight used on this page.
How much heavier will the Kawasaki VN 1500 Classic Tourer be than its dry weight?
Do not treat dry weight as curb weight. Adding the listed fuel capacity alone produces roughly 756 lb (342.9 kg); the true ready-to-ride figure can still differ because dry-weight definitions vary.
